SA 2538. Mr. WELCH submitted an amendment intended to be proposed to
amendment SA 2360 proposed by Mr. Thune (for Mr. Graham) to the bill
H.R. 1, to provide for reconciliation pursuant to title II of H. Con.
Res. 14; which was ordered to lie on the table; as follows:
Strike section 70106 and insert the following:
SEC. 70106. EXTENSION AND ENHANCEMENT OF INCREASED ESTATE AND
GIFT TAX EXEMPTION AMOUNTS.
(a) In General.--Section 2010(c)(3) is amended--
(1) in subparagraph (A) by striking ``$5,000,000'' and
inserting ``$15,000,000 (or, in the case of a decedent whose
income for the preceding taxable year was greater than
$100,000,000, $5,000,000)'',
(2) in subparagraph (B)--
(A) in the matter preceding clause (i), by striking
``2011'' and inserting ``2026'', and
(B) in clause (ii), by striking ``calendar year 2010'' and
inserting ``calendar year 2025'', and
(3) by striking subparagraph (C).
(b) Effective Date.--The amendments made by this section
shall apply to estates of decedents dying and gifts made
after December 31, 2025.
